#b36cd0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b36cd0 is composed of 70.2% red, 42.4% green and 81.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 13.9% cyan, 48.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 282.6 degrees, a saturation of 51.5% and a lightness of 62%. #b36cd0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d8ff with #6700a1.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

Shades and Tints of #b36cd0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010102 is the darkest color, while #f8f2f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#b36cd0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a099a3 is the less saturated color, while #c63ffd is the most saturated one.
